30/09/1945 Kilmarnock Works The Clans noted at Kilmarnock are 14763/5, both withdrawn. This works is now doing a considerable amount of repair work, including complete strips. The largest machine work is done at St. Rollox (for example wheel turning), but additional machinery has been sent from Derby to enable much of the work to be done on the spot. SLS/194601
